In the manner of a film diary, and with a fresh, intimate style reminiscent of Agnès Varda, director Zoé Chantre reflects on her relationship with the world at a key moment in her life.

The Perpetual Leek (Le poireau perpétuel), directed by Zoé Chantre. France, 2021. 83’. Original soundtrack with Spanish subtitles

Like any good diary, this film begins with a date: 5 March. Every year, on that day, an ant comes through the director’s door, announcing that spring is just around the corner. That date also happens to be her mother’s birthday. But this year it is different; her mother has cancer, and faced with a life that threatens to unravel, Zoé begins to wonder if it is time for her to become a mother.

With a keen sense of humour, ingenious visual resources and painstaking observation of the smallest details in search of connections between art and society, the film shows the everyday reality of a director who, as if her life were not already complicated enough, must also live with an abnormal curvature of the spine and the consequences of a brain tumour she suffered as a child, including trips to India and Vietnam.

The film had its world premiere at FIDMarseille 2021, where it won three awards. This will be its first screening in Spain.

Zoé Chantre is a filmmaker, set designer and visual artist, born in France in 1981. She graduated from the Strasbourg École supérieure des arts décoratifs (E.S.A.D.) in 2007, and in 2012 the Berlinale premiered her first feature film, Tiens-moi droite, also based on her own personal experiences.
